Agile Space Industries seeks a Product Lead for in-space propulsion systems to own the technical roadmap and support both business development and program execution. You will coordinate across engineering, manufacturing, and program teams to translate mission needs into technical requirements and a compelling product plan.
The role emphasizes leading technical activities for proposals, driving gated design reviews, and ensuring a seamless handoff to programs.
Product Leads within Agile support the development and execution of our expanding integrated systems product line. This role is responsible for owning the product line, product definition, roadmap planning support, and technical coordination activities supporting both business development and program execution efforts. The product lead for integrated systems will have a highly influential role, shaping how Agile designs, builds, and delivers integrated systems to our customers.
The Product Lead works with technical fellows to define the technical roadmap for the product line. This role works across engineering, manufacturing, program management, and business development teams to refine product direction, establish technical requirements, and ensure alignment between customer mission needs and product capabilities.
The Product Lead will own the technical volume for proposals and ensure the product line technical roadmap is reflected in proposal efforts. The Product Lead will also own the technical product details used to support marking and sales, such as fly sheets. This role will oversee the initial establishment of product requirements from proposal award through SRR, ensuring an effective handoff to the program systems engineering team.
This Product Lead is expected to take ownership of assigned product areas, support technical planning activities, and help ensure products are positioned to meet long-term company and customer objectives. Propulsion systems is a growing product area for Agile, this role will have the opportunity to establish strategic relationships with external parties, both customers and suppliers.
